Travis Dean

Travis Dean is an American voice actor known for his work in English dubs of anime series, primarily during the early 2000s. He is most recognized for providing the English voice of James Links in the television series Zone of the Enders: Dolores, i. This science fiction series, produced by ADV Films, follows the story of the Links family as they become entangled in an interplanetary conflict involving a powerful robotic weapon known as an Orbital Frame. His role as James Links, the hard-drinking cargo hauler and patriarch of the family, stands as his most prominent credit.
Beyond this lead role, Dean's career consisted of numerous supporting and guest voice parts in a variety of anime titles distributed in North America. A significant portion of his work was for ADV Films, a major anime licensor and distributor at the time. His other voice credits include roles in series such as 801 T.T.S. Airbats, Eden's Bowy, Final Fantasy: Unlimited, Getbackers, Lost Universe, Nadia: The Secret of Blue Water, and Petite Princess Yucie. He also contributed to several original video animations (OAVs), including Getter Robo: Armageddon, New Fist of the North Star, and Ninja Resurrection, for which he served as the narrator. His body of work reflects a consistent presence in the English-dub industry during a prolific period of anime localization, though a comprehensive overview of his career achievements and collaborations is limited by the available information.
